343 Industries shared in a separate blog post from the December update that new advanced controller settings would also be coming to Halo 5: Guardians.

First the look acceleration determines how fast you turn, and is currently at a default value of 3, faster than previous Halo games and the Halo 5 multiplayer beta. If you prefer to crank it back down, 343i suggests setting it to 2 when the option is implemented. For those who want to do a much quicker 180 degree turn, you are now free to turn the setting up to a maximum of 10.

The inner dead zone option allows players to further tweak their look options, as it will determine when the controller registers camera movement from the analog stick. The lower the percentage in this option, the quicker your analog stick movement will be recognized. However, not all analog sticks return to the center due to wear and tear, so experiment to ensure the best performance.

Lastly, the outer dead zone determines you when you have received maximum look speed and prevents what is known as "slow turn." As with the inner dead zone, this is something that will be a player by player change depending on your analog stick and personal preference.

This update will not change any current defaults, and so long as you refrain from touching them the game will control the same way, however for those desiring a much more customized control scheme, have at it.
